Prime Minister Imran Khan inaugurated a low-cost housing colony for labourers and industrial workers on Wednesday.
The PM said the housing scheme for workers in Peshawar was launched in 2011 but it remained incomplete since it was not a priority because it was meant for the poor labourers. He said he wanted to see how much the condition of the poor had improved after the five-year tenure of the PTI government.
This new project has now been put under the ‘Naya Pakistan Housing Scheme’.
However, a report by Journalist Izharullah sets the record straight about the origins of the scheme.
